Mother’s Day Card Embroidery Design
p>The Mother’s Day Card Embroidery Design immediately evokes a warm, heartfelt tone perfect for the holiday. The pink envelope motif with a heart message is simple yet expressive, offering a cute and romantic aesthetic that appeals to a wide audience. As an embroidery designer, I appreciate how the design balances detail without being overly complex, making it ideal for both novice and experienced stitchers. It’s also a great asset for social media previews and printable mockups, helping shoppers envision the final product before purchase. h2>Design Considerations: Where to Be Mindful p>While the Mother’s Day Card Embroidery Design is versatile, there are a few practical considerations to keep in mind: li>Small hoop sizes may limit the full design’s placement or require scaling down li>Tiny lettering can be difficult to read after stitching, especially on textured fabrics li>Layered details might not stitch cleanly on thick or uneven materials like towels li>Dark fabric may require underlay adjustments or light thread choices for visibility li>Metallic thread should be used sparingly to avoid breakage or distortion li>Stretchy garments will need extra stabilizer support to prevent puckering li>Curved caps or irregular surfaces may not be ideal for intricate parts of the design p>If you're planning to use this in commercial embroidery, always verify licensing terms before selling finished products.
